Essential Functions

  • Perform prompt and competent completion of analyses of intellectual property protection and strategies to enable timely technology transfer of Purdue intellectual property.
  • Work cooperatively with Purdue inventors and Office of Technology Commercialization (OTC) licensing staff to evaluate technology-based innovations for appropriate intellectual property protection.
  • Draft patent applications and present applications to US Patent and Trademark Office and copyright registrations to US Copyright Office for the benefit of Purdue.
  • Prosecute patent applications with respect to all aspects of patent law, including preparing formal communications and responses to national patent offices, conducting examiner interviews and related prosecution activities for the benefit of Purdue.
  • Engage and manage outside counsel on patent prosecution matters including coordinate, manage and account for budget expenditures associated with all assigned project-related activities.

Additional Responsibilities

  • Work cooperatively with Office of Technology Commercialization (OTC) business development managers in the evaluation of intellectual property landscapes.
  • Assist in due diligence of legal matters relating to any matter.
  • Represent Purdue and OTC with national organizations, associations and groups related to university commercialization.
  • Responsible for oversight of legal externship programs, including providing mentorship to visiting legal externs.

  • Required Education / Experience and Benefits

  • Patent practice experience in physical sciences required.
  • Experience and / or expertise in electrical and computer engineering or computer science is a plus.
  • 2-4 years of direct patent drafting and prosecution experience before US Patent and Trademark Office
  • Registered with US Patent and Trademark Office (Patent Agent or Patent Attorney)
  • Member of Indiana or a reciprocating state Bar preferred.
